Stewed Pork Ribs with Sauerkraut.

1. Boil the ribs in hot water and remove them.

2. Cut the sauerkraut into thin strips and set aside.

3. Prepare the green onion, ginger, garlic, eight peppers, bay leaves, Chinese pepper and dried red peppers.

4. Cut two slices of tofu into small pieces for later use.

5. Put half of the chopped green onion, garlic and ginger into the pot, and simmer with the ribs for 40 minutes.

6. Put the peanut oil in the wok, add the remaining half, fry the onion, ginger, garlic and various seasonings to create a fragrance.

7. Add sauerkraut and stir fry.

8. Put the freshly fried sauerkraut into the ribs that have been simmered for 40 minutes, and then simmer for 10 to 15 minutes. Add the right amount of salt and chicken essence according to the taste to get out of the pot.

Tips:

Because the salt is already in the pickled cabbage, don't put too much salt in this dish, and finally add an appropriate amount of salt to taste according to the taste before being out of the pot.
